A well-written contract is your foundation for a successful retreat engagement. It protects both you and the retreat organiser, sets clear expectations, and helps prevent common misunderstandings that can come up in retreat settings. Unlike standard catering contracts, retreat work often involves extended periods, specialised dietary requirements, and unique venue conditions that all need consideration.
